English Language Arts
- Enhanced reading skills through reading in-game instructions, communicating with other players, and exploring virtual worlds.
- Developed writing skills by sharing experiences and strategies with other players on forums or in chat.
- Expanded vocabulary through exposure to various in-game terms, commands, and dialogue.
- Practiced critical thinking and problem-solving skills by strategizing, analyzing game mechanics, and overcoming challenges within the game.
History
- Gained historical knowledge by playing historically-themed Roblox games, such as those set in ancient civilizations or historical events.
- Explored different time periods and cultures through virtual environments, which can spark curiosity and further research.
- Developed an understanding of cause and effect as they navigate historical scenarios and learn about the consequences of certain actions.
- Learned about historical figures and events through in-game narratives and storylines.
Social Studies
- Explored various social structures within the game, such as communities, economies, and governments, which can provide insights into real-world social dynamics.
- Developed an understanding of collaboration and teamwork by participating in multiplayer games and working towards common goals with other players.
- Gained exposure to different cultures and perspectives, as Roblox has a global player base with diverse backgrounds.
- Strengthened digital citizenship skills by interacting with others respectfully, following community guidelines, and reporting inappropriate behavior.
Encourage continued development by incorporating language arts and social studies concepts into gameplay. For example, the child can write their own stories or create in-game quests that involve research on historical events or explore themes related to social issues. They can also join or create groups focused on literature or history within the Roblox community to engage in discussions and collaborate on projects.
Book Recommendations
- "The Ultimate Roblox Book: An Unofficial Guide" by David Jagneaux: A comprehensive guide that offers tips, strategies, and insights into various aspects of Roblox, including game creation and community interaction.
- "The History Book: Big Ideas Simply Explained" by DK: Provides a visually engaging overview of world history, making it a great resource for expanding historical knowledge beyond the game.
- "The Giver" by Lois Lowry: Explores themes of dystopian society and individuality, which can complement discussions on social studies topics like governance and societal structures.
